“…For the 3D reconstruction of uncalibrated images, the most commonly used method is the motion recovery structure method. is method uses numerical methods to detect and match feature point sets in the image, at the same time, recover the camera motion parameters and scene geometry, and obtain the 3D model of the object [18]. When shooting the target, you can freely move the position of the camera and adjust the focal length of the camera as needed; since there is no need to calibrate the camera parameters in advance, the reconstruction result will not be affected by factors such as inaccurate calibration information or slight changes in camera parameters during the shooting process.…”

“…Digital 3-D models of retouchers were created using a RangeVision PRO 5M structured-light scanner. After scanning, models were processed using RangeVisionScanCenter and RangeVisionScanMerge software (Kolobova et al, 2019b). All models were then oriented in one perspective with the active retouching area in the northern or uppermost position.…”
